How to analyse lyrics


In the second week of Dan’s lesson we were practising how to analyse lyrics and put our own views into them. The lyrics we had to analyse were from an old song called “ alight” by super-grass. We first watched the music video before we were given a copy of the lyrics to analyse.
“Alright” by super grass
In the eyes of Andrew Goodwin this would be seen as being a disjuncture as the lyrics from beginning to the end contradict the music video making it in my opinion pretty worthless. The way that I analysed these lyrics were by looking at each paragraph and whatever image came up in my mind I would classify it as an idea.
